As an IT leader, you're always expected to keep up as business goals change.

But there is often a lack of direction.

You’re asked to “support innovation,” “increase agility,” or “enable growth,” but not always told what that means in terms of systems, architecture, or budget.

Effective strategic planning can help you find a sense of direction in such situations.

It provides a structured approach to aligning technology with evolving business priorities and translating broad goals into specific, actionable initiatives.
